低代码开发热点:开启企业数字化转型新征程
在当今数字化浪潮下,企业对信息化的需求日益增长。传统软件开发交付慢、软件变更多、企业需求难以快速满足等痛点,严重制约着企业的发展。而低代码开发作为一种新兴的开发方式,正逐渐成为解决这些问题的关键,成为当下的热门话题。
低代码开发概念与原理
低代码开发,简单来说,就是通过可视化的界面,利用拖拽组件和配置参数的方式,快速构建应用程序,无需大量编写代码。其原理基于预先构建好的组件库、模板库以及强大的流程引擎。例如,在开发一个OA系统时,开发者无需从底层代码开始编写,而是像搭建积木一样,将诸如用户登录、审批流程、文件管理等组件拖拽到设计界面,并通过简单的配置来定义它们的功能和相互关系。
低代码开发的应用场景
1. **OA系统开发**:低代码平台能快速搭建企业办公自动化系统,涵盖请假、报销、文件审批等流程。以某中型企业为例,过去搭建一套OA系统,采用传统开发方式,从需求调研到上线,耗时近6个月。而借助低代码平台,仅用了3周时间就完成了基本功能的搭建,大大缩短了开发周期,提高了办公效率。
2. **ERP系统构建**:在企业资源规划领域,低代码开发可助力快速整合财务、采购、生产等模块。比如一家制造企业,利用低代码平台在2个月内构建了简易的ERP系统,实现了生产流程的数字化管理,解决了各部门数据流通不畅的问题。
低代码开发需注意的事项
1. **避免盲目追求速度忽视逻辑**:有些企业在使用低代码搭建工作流时,为了快速上线,过度简化流程逻辑。例如,在审批流程中,跳过关键的审核节点,导致后期出现管理漏洞。企业应在追求速度的同时,确保流程的合理性和严谨性。
2. **注意系统适配性**:不能只看低代码平台功能多少,而忽视与企业实际业务的适配性。比如生产型企业直接套用办公型的审批模板,就会导致流程不适用。企业需根据自身业务特点,对模板进行二次开发或定制化配置。
3. **权限管理要清晰**:在OA低代码系统中,不同角色如管理员、员工、部门负责人等的权限划分必须明确。否则,可能出现员工越权操作、数据泄露等问题。例如,曾有企业因权限设置混乱,普通员工可随意修改财务数据,给企业带来了严重损失。
低代码开发的优势与传统开发对比
1. **效率与门槛角度**:传统开发搭建一套标准化OA工作流,需经历需求调研、代码编写、测试迭代等复杂流程,往往需要2 - 3个月。而低代码平台通过拖拽式组件、预制模板,相同功能的工作流可在3 - 7天内完成。这种显著的效率提升,特别适合中小企业快速上线业务系统的需求。例如,一家创业公司想快速搭建一个项目管理系统,若采用传统开发,时间和成本都难以承受,而低代码开发仅用了5天就完成了系统搭建,使其能迅速开展业务。
2. **技术门槛的“高”与“低”**:传统开发的核心用户是专业程序员,需掌握Java、Python等编程语言,对普通业务人员而言难度极大。低代码则面向“非技术群体”,如企业行政、业务主管等,通过可视化界面即可搭建工作流。比如财务人员可以利用低代码平台,自行搭建报销流程,无需依赖IT部门,打破了技术垄断。
低代码开发的热点平台推荐
Gadmin企业级开发平台,拥有9年的开发经验,是PHP低代码平台中相当优秀的存在,曾入选10大PHP低代码开发平台。其丰富的组件库和强大的功能,能满足企业多样化的开发需求。TPflow工作流引擎,作为国内优秀的PHP工作流引擎,是PHP低代码核心引擎的佼佼者,为低代码开发提供了高效稳定的流程支持。
结语
低代码开发正以其独特的优势,成为企业数字化转型的有力工具。但在应用过程中,企业需充分认识其特点,规避常见误区,选择合适的平台,才能真正发挥低代码开发的价值,推动企业的快速发展。
评论
发表评论